Why do you need Forex Signals?

Forex signals are sent out daily in real-time or as a possible prediction. There are different notification methods. The most common are Twitter, websites or email. 

New on the market are algorithmic signals, so-called algo signals, which are determined by programs and follow an algorithm. These are then sent as SMS to the smartphone. 

The type of Forex signal depends on how it works. In principle, two types of Forex signals are available on the Forex market: manual forex signals and automatic forex signals. When using manual forex signals, the first thing to note is that you as a trader spend a lot of time in front of the computer must, since such signals rarely relate to direct purchase decisions.

The most interesting Forex signal systems:

In manual Forex signal systems, the signals come from a human analyst. This has to look for price movements to interpret them. An analyst's mental and psychological condition always influences the decisions to be made.

With automatic Forex signal systems, the signals are generated by robots. The program follows predetermined steps and learns itself based on previous price movements.

Unfortunately, there are always scammers on the Forex market who offer false and unreliable Forex signals, which could cost you a lot of money if you don't pay attention. You should therefore always conduct sufficient research to ensure that they are trustworthy providers. 

Dealing with Forex signals and analysis requires basic knowledge in Forex trading for manual signals.
